@charset "UTF-8";*,*:before,*:after{margin:0;padding:0;box-sizing:border-box}ul,ol{list-style:none}h1,h2,h3,h4,h5,h6{font-weight:400;font-size:inherit}a{text-decoration:none;color:inherit}button,input,select,textarea{font:inherit;color:inherit;background:none;border:none;outline:none}img{display:block;max-width:100%;height:auto}:root{--color-1: hsla(0, 0%, 100%, 1);--color-2: hsla(180, 2%, 12%, 1);--color-3: hsl(150, 30%, 60%);--color-4: hsla(0, 0%, 0%, 1);--color-5: hsla(0, 0%, 95%, 1);--bg-page: var(--color-1);--primary-color: var(--color-1);--secondary-color: var(--color-5);--accent-color: var(--color-3);--accent-color-opacity:hsla(150, 30%, 60%, .423);--text-light: var(--color-1);--text-dark: var(--color-2);--bg-footer: var(--color-4)}.no-scroll{overflow:hidden!important;height:100%}.x-center{margin-left:auto;margin-right:auto}.wrapper{max-width:1840px;padding-left:24px;padding-right:24px}.no-select{-webkit-user-select:none;user-select:none}.d-none{display:none}.ghost-mode{opacity:.4;pointer-events:none}.overlay{position:fixed;inset:0;z-index:400;background-color:#0009}.sr-only-text{font-size:1px;color:transparent}.sr-only{position:absolute!important;width:1px!important;height:1px!important;padding:0!important;margin:-1px!important;overflow:hidden!important;clip:rect(0,0,0,0)!important;clip-path:inset(50%)!important;white-space:nowrap!important;border:0!important}.burger-btn{display:flex;flex-direction:column;justify-content:space-between;width:24px;height:24px}.burger-btn__line{display:block;width:100%;height:2px;background-color:var(--color-4);transition:transform .1s;cursor:pointer}.burger-btn__line--top,.burger-btn__line--bottom{transform:translateY(0);transform-origin:center}.burger-btn--active .burger-btn__line:nth-child(1){transform:translateY(11px) rotate(45deg) scaleX(1.3)}.burger-btn--active .burger-btn__line:nth-child(2){opacity:0}.burger-btn--active .burger-btn__line:nth-child(3){transform:translateY(-11px) rotate(-45deg) scaleX(1.3)}.breadcrumb{font-weight:400;font-size:10px;line-height:1;letter-spacing:.06em;text-transform:uppercase}.breadcrumb__list{display:flex;gap:8px}.breadcrumb__item:not(:first-child):before{content:"•";display:inline-block;margin-right:8px}.link-btn{padding:22px 57px;border-radius:4px;background-color:var(--accent-color);font-family:Inter;font-weight:500;font-size:12px;line-height:1;letter-spacing:.06em;text-transform:uppercase}@media (hover: hover){.link-btn{transition:filter .3s}.link-btn:hover{filter:brightness(1.2)}}.list-nav{display:flex;gap:24px}.switch{position:relative;display:inline-block;width:36px;height:22px}.switch__input{opacity:0;width:0;height:0}.switch__input:checked+.switch__slider{background-color:var(--accent-color)}.switch__input:focus+.switch__slider{outline:solid var(--accent-color) 1px}.switch__input:checked+.switch__slider:before{transform:translateY(-50%) translate(18px)}.switch__slider{position:absolute;cursor:pointer;inset:0;background-color:var(--secondary-color);transition:.4s}.switch__slider:before{position:absolute;content:"";height:8px;width:8px;left:5px;top:50%;background-color:var(--text-dark);transition:.4s;transform:translateY(-50%)}.switch__slider--round{border-radius:34px}.switch__slider--round:before{border-radius:50%}.form-filter__field{display:flex;align-items:center;gap:12px;color:#1f2020;font-size:12px;font-weight:400;line-height:1;letter-spacing:.06em;text-transform:uppercase}.header{position:fixed;z-index:500;width:100vw;background-color:var(--primary-color);color:var(--text-dark)}.header__content{position:relative;display:flex;align-items:center;padding-top:38px;padding-bottom:40px;line-height:1}@media (max-width: 1173px){.header__content{justify-content:center}}@media (max-width: 768px){.header__content{justify-content:space-between}}@media (max-width: 480px){.header__content:before{position:absolute;content:"";left:24px;bottom:0;right:24px;height:1px;background-color:#0009}}.header__mobile-menu{display:contents;height:100vh;background-color:#e7e4de;transition:transform .3s}@media (max-width: 768px){.header__mobile-menu{display:block;position:fixed;top:0;left:0;z-index:1000;width:min(300px,90vw);height:100vh;padding:200px 20px 100px 60px;transform:translate(-100vw)}}.header__mobile-menu--active{overflow-y:auto}@media (max-width: 1173px){.header__mobile-menu--active .header__tablet-menu{transform:translate(0)}}@media (max-width: 768px){.header__mobile-menu--active{transform:translate(0)}}.header__tablet-menu{display:contents;height:100vh;transition:transform .3s;background-color:#e7e4de}@media (max-width: 1173px){.header__tablet-menu{position:fixed;top:0;left:0;z-index:1000;display:block;width:40vw;padding:200px 60px 100px;transform:translate(-100vw)}}@media (max-width: 768px){.header__tablet-menu{display:contents}}.header__burger-btn{display:none}@media (max-width: 1173px){.header__burger-btn{position:relative;z-index:1100;display:flex;margin-right:auto}}@media (max-width: 768px){.header__burger-btn{margin-right:0}}@media (max-width: 1173px){.header__logo{margin-right:auto;padding-left:150px}}@media (max-width: 768px){.header__logo{margin-right:0;padding-left:0}}.header__nav{padding-left:20px;padding-right:20px;margin-left:8.7%;font-weight:400;font-size:14px;line-height:1;letter-spacing:.06em;text-transform:uppercase}@media (max-width: 1400px){.header__nav{margin-left:2%;padding-left:0;padding-right:15px}}@media (max-width: 1173px){.header__nav{margin-bottom:50px}}@media (max-width: 1173px){.header__list{display:flex;flex-direction:column}}.header__contacts{margin-left:auto}@media (max-width: 1173px){.header__contacts{margin-left:0}}@media (max-width: 1173px){.header__contacts{margin-bottom:50px}}.header__actions{display:flex;align-items:center;gap:24px;margin-left:6.6%}@media (max-width: 1400px){.header__actions{margin-left:20px}}@media (max-width: 1173px){.header__actions{margin-left:0}}.header__phone{display:block;font-weight:500;font-size:16px;letter-spacing:-.02em}.header__callback{font-size:14px;opacity:.3}.header__icon{display:flex;align-items:center;width:22px;height:22px}.header__cart{flex-shrink:0;width:24px;height:24px;margin-left:1.2%;border-radius:50%;background-color:var(--accent-color);font-size:12px;line-height:1;text-align:center;text-transform:uppercase;cursor:pointer}@media (max-width: 1173px){.header__cart{margin-left:20px}}@media (max-width: 768px){.header__cart{margin-left:0}}.footer{min-height:200px;background-color:var(--bg-footer)}.products{display:grid;grid-template-columns:auto 1fr;gap:7.7%;min-height:calc(100vh + 1px);padding-top:82px}@media (max-width: 1440px){.products{padding-top:60px;gap:60px}}@media (max-width: 1280px){.products{grid-template-columns:1fr}}.products__catalog{display:flex;flex-direction:column;padding-bottom:157px}.products__catalog-header{display:flex;justify-content:space-between;padding-bottom:50px;color:var(--text-dark);font-weight:500;font-size:12px;line-height:100%;letter-spacing:.06em;text-transform:uppercase}.products__overlay-filter{display:contents}@media (max-width: 480px){.products__overlay-filter{display:flex;align-items:flex-end;background-color:#000000b5;position:fixed;top:0;left:0;bottom:0;z-index:2000;transform:translateY(-100%);transition:opacity .5s;opacity:0}}@media (max-width: 480px){.products__overlay-filter--active{opacity:1;transform:translateY(0)}}.products__filter{display:flex;flex-direction:column;gap:10px}@media (max-width: 1280px){.products__filter{flex-direction:row;flex-wrap:wrap}}@media (max-width: 480px){.products__filter{position:relative;flex-direction:column;width:100vw;padding:54px 24px 114px;background-color:var(--primary-color);border-top-left-radius:24px;border-top-right-radius:24px}.products__filter:before{position:absolute;content:"";top:12px;left:50%;width:28px;height:4px;border-radius:40px;background-color:#212121;transform:translate(-50%);opacity:.6}}.products__filter-btn{display:none}@media (max-width: 480px){.products__filter-btn{display:block;font-weight:500;font-size:12px;leading-trim:NONE;line-height:1;letter-spacing:.06em;text-transform:uppercase}}@media (max-width: 480px){.products__quantity{position:absolute;opacity:0;pointer-events:none}}.panel-aside{display:flex;justify-content:flex-end;height:100vh;width:100vw;background-color:#504f4f4b;transition:transform .3s,background-color .3s .3s}.panel-aside__content{max-width:600px;width:100%;height:100%;display:flex;flex-direction:column;padding:32px 40px 40px;background-color:var(--primary-color);transform:translate(0);transition:transform .3s;overflow-y:auto}@media (max-width: 768px){.panel-aside__content{padding:40px 24px}}.panel-aside__content-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:80px}@media (max-width: 768px){.panel-aside__content-header{margin-bottom:40px}}.panel-aside__close-btn{display:flex;align-items:center;justify-content:center;width:48px;height:48px;border:solid 1px rgba(0,0,0,.098);border-radius:50%;cursor:pointer}.panel-aside__title{font-weight:500;font-size:30px;letter-spacing:-.04em}.panel-aside__content-main{flex-grow:1}.panel-aside__cart-info{display:flex;justify-content:space-between;padding-bottom:10px}.panel-aside__cart-quantity{font-weight:400;font-size:14px;line-height:1.12;letter-spacing:0}.panel-aside__cart-clear-btn{font-weight:300;font-size:14px;line-height:1.12;letter-spacing:0;text-transform:lowercase;opacity:.4;cursor:pointer}.panel-aside__products-list{max-height:500px;overflow-y:auto;padding-right:10px;margin-bottom:100px}.panel-aside__products-list::-webkit-scrollbar{width:4px}.panel-aside__products-list::-webkit-scrollbar-thumb{background:#e0dada8e;border-radius:2px}.panel-aside__products-list::-webkit-scrollbar-track{background:transparent}.panel-aside__product-item{display:flex;justify-content:space-between;align-items:center;gap:20px;padding-top:12px;padding-bottom:12px;border-top:solid rgba(0,0,0,.1) 1px}.panel-aside__item-delete,.panel-aside__item-restore{width:24px;height:24px;background-image:url(/colors/images/x.svg);background-repeat:no-repeat;cursor:pointer}.panel-aside__item-restore{background-image:url(/colors/images/repeat.svg)}.panel-aside__content-footer{display:flex;justify-content:space-between;flex-wrap:wrap;gap:20px}.panel-aside__total{padding-top:6px}.panel-aside__total-price{min-width:200px;font-weight:500;font-size:30px;line-height:1}.panel-aside__total-title{font-weight:400;font-size:16px}.panel-aside--fix{position:fixed;top:0;right:0;z-index:2000}.panel-aside--hidden{background-color:#504f4f00;transition:transform .3s,background-color 0s;transform:translate(100%)}.panel-aside--hidden .panel-aside__content{transform:translate(100%)}.hero{position:relative}.hero__breadcrumb{position:absolute;z-index:100;top:22px;left:64px;padding:10px;color:var(--text-light);opacity:.4}@media (max-width: 1840px){.hero__breadcrumb{left:14px}}@media (max-width: 480px){.hero__breadcrumb{position:relative;top:initial;left:initial;padding:16px 24px;margin-bottom:32px;color:var(--text-dark)}}.hero__info{position:absolute;top:50%;left:50%;z-index:100;transform:translate(-50%,-50%)}@media (max-width: 480px){.hero__info{position:relative;top:initial;left:initial;transform:initial}}.hero__title{margin-bottom:24px;color:var(--text-light);font-weight:400;font-size:clamp(36px,4.5vw + 16px,72px);line-height:.8;letter-spacing:-.02em;text-align:center}@media (max-width: 768px){.hero__title{padding-left:24px;padding-right:24px;margin-bottom:0;text-align:left}}@media (max-width: 480px){.hero__title{color:var(--text-dark)}}.hero__paragraph{max-width:472px;width:100%;color:var(--text-light);font-weight:500;font-size:16px;line-height:1.3;letter-spacing:.022em;word-spacing:.02em;text-align:center}@media (max-width: 768px){.hero__paragraph{font-size:1px;opacity:0}}@media (max-width: 480px){.hero__slider{display:none}}.hero__slider-item{width:100vw}.hero__slider-img{min-height:560px}@media (max-width: 1440px){.hero__slider-img{min-height:50vw}}.hero__container-icons{position:absolute;left:50%;bottom:39px;transform:translate(-50%);padding:13px 24px}@media (max-width: 768px){.hero__container-icons{padding:6px 12px}}.slider{position:relative;width:100%;overflow:hidden}.slider:hover{cursor:grab}.slider:active{cursor:grabbing}.slider__track{display:flex;transform:translate(0);touch-action:none;transition:transform .4s linear;will-change:transform}.slider__item{flex-shrink:0;flex-grow:0;background-color:#7fffd4}.slider__img{width:100%;height:100%;object-fit:cover}.slider__btn{position:absolute;top:50%;width:80px;height:80px;transform:translateY(-50%);cursor:pointer}.slider__btn--next{right:42px}@media (max-width: 1840px){.slider__btn--next{right:0}}.slider__btn--prev{left:42px}@media (max-width: 1840px){.slider__btn--prev{left:0}}.slider__container-icons{display:flex;gap:8px;border-radius:16px;background-color:#0006}.slider__icon{width:6px;height:6px;border-radius:50%;background-color:var(--primary-color);opacity:.2}.slider__icon--active{opacity:1}.list-products{display:grid;grid-template-columns:repeat(auto-fill,minmax(156px,278px));gap:24px;justify-content:center}.list-products__item{min-height:392px;padding-bottom:16px;border-bottom:solid gray 1px}.sort{position:relative;min-width:280px;color:var(--text-dark)}.sort--text-left{text-align:right}.sort__selected{cursor:pointer}.sort__items{display:none;position:absolute;top:0;z-index:100;flex-direction:column;min-width:280px;background-color:var(--primary-color)}.sort__items--open{display:flex}.sort__item{display:flex;align-items:center;min-height:48px;padding-left:24px;cursor:pointer}@media (hover: hover){.sort__item:hover:not(.sort__item--selected){background-color:var(--accent-color-opacity)}}.sort__item:focus{background-color:var(--accent-color)}.sort__item--selected{background-color:var(--accent-color)}html{overflow-y:scroll}body{min-height:calc(100vh + 1px);background-color:var(--bg-page);font-family:Inter,sans-serif}.main{padding-top:110px}.product{display:flex;flex-direction:column;justify-content:space-between;width:100%;height:100%}@media (hover: hover){.product:hover .product__btn{opacity:1}}.product__image-wrapper{display:flex;justify-content:center;align-items:center;height:278px;margin-bottom:16px}.product__footer{display:flex;justify-content:space-between;align-items:flex-end}.product__price{font-weight:600}@media (hover: hover){.product__btn{opacity:0;transition:filter .3s}.product__btn:hover{filter:brightness(1.2)}}.product__btn:active{transform:scale(.98)}.cart-button{cursor:pointer}.cart-button--add{width:80px;height:32px;border-radius:8px;background-color:#7eb99b;background-image:url(/colors/images/add.svg);background-repeat:no-repeat;background-position:center}.cart-button--increase,.cart-button--decrease{width:40px;height:24px;border-radius:4px;background-color:var(--secondary-color);background-repeat:no-repeat;background-position:center}.cart-button--increase{background-image:url("data:image/svg+xml,%3csvg%20width='20'%20height='20'%20viewBox='0%200%2020%2020'%20fill='none'%20xmlns='http://www.w3.org/2000/svg'%3e%3cpath%20d='M10%204.16663V15.8333'%20stroke='%231F2020'%20stroke-width='2'%20stroke-linecap='round'%20stroke-linejoin='round'/%3e%3cpath%20d='M4.16699%2010H15.8337'%20stroke='%231F2020'%20stroke-width='2'%20stroke-linecap='round'%20stroke-linejoin='round'/%3e%3c/svg%3e")}.cart-button--decrease{background-image:url("data:image/svg+xml,%3csvg%20width='16.000000'%20height='16.000000'%20viewBox='0%200%2016%2016'%20fill='none'%20xmlns='http://www.w3.org/2000/svg'%20xmlns:xlink='http://www.w3.org/1999/xlink'%3e%3cdesc%3e%20Created%20with%20Pixso.%20%3c/desc%3e%3cdefs%3e%3cclipPath%20id='clip8_1451'%3e%3crect%20id='minus'%20rx='0.000000'%20width='15.000000'%20height='15.000000'%20transform='translate(0.500000%200.500000)'%20fill='white'%20fill-opacity='0'/%3e%3c/clipPath%3e%3c/defs%3e%3crect%20id='minus'%20rx='0.000000'%20width='15.000000'%20height='15.000000'%20transform='translate(0.500000%200.500000)'%20fill='%23FFFFFF'%20fill-opacity='0'/%3e%3cg%20clip-path='url(%23clip8_1451)'%3e%3cpath%20id='Vector'%20d='M3.33%208L12.66%208'%20stroke='%23000000'%20stroke-opacity='1.000000'%20stroke-width='1.400000'%20stroke-linejoin='round'%20stroke-linecap='round'/%3e%3c/g%3e%3c/svg%3e")}.product-cart{display:flex;align-items:center;gap:20px;max-width:460px;width:100%;min-height:96px}@media (max-width: 768px){.product-cart{flex-direction:column;text-align:center}}.product-cart__left{flex-shrink:0;position:relative;display:flex;width:96px}.product-cart__center{flex-shrink:0;max-width:169px}.product-cart__right{display:flex;gap:14px;margin-left:auto}@media (max-width: 768px){.product-cart__right{margin-left:0}}.product-cart__img{width:100%;height:100%;object-fit:contain}.product-cart__title{margin-bottom:16px;font-weight:300;font-size:16px;line-height:1.12;letter-spacing:.02em;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}
